4. Consider the Water Jug Problem that is stated as follows: You have two empty jugs, measuring 4 gallons and 3 gallons, and a water faucet. Neither have any measuring markers. You can fill the jugs up or empty them out from one to another or onto the ground. It is desirable to have exactly 2 gallons of water into the 4 -gallon jug. a) Propose a state space representation for the Water Jug Problem.
